Put an INR Nav system from an older GM vehicle in my '07 Classic that worked fine for 3 months but has begun giving me "XM Error" messages and won't recognize the stock satellite system. Have done quite a bit of digging and found TSB 01662 that seems to relate to Nav systems and this error message. Was hoping I might be able to get the full text for the TSB. Ok, thanks for looking. Here is the record according to the NHTSA site -

 

 

Make : GMC Model : SIERRA Year : 2003

Manufacturer : GENERAL MOTORS CORP.

Service Bulletin Num : 01662 Date of Bulletin: JAN 01, 2004

NHTSA Item Number: 10007248

Component: EQUIPMENT:ELECTRICAL:RADIO/TAPE DECK/CD ETC.

Summary Description:

XM ERROR ON A RADIO DISPLAY. *TT
